About Digby Wrede
Digby Wrede is a scholar working on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ment, Molecular Biology, Oceanography, Environmental Chemistry and Infectious Diseases, having authored 4 papers that have together received 411 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Algal biology and biofuel production (4 papers), Aquatic Ecosystems and Phytoplankton Dynamics (1 paper), Enzyme Catalysis and Immobilization (1 paper), Microbial Metabolic Engineering and Bioproduction (1 paper) and Marine and coastal ecosystems (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(339 citations), Environmental Chemistry (51 citations), Pollution (35 citations),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ering (25 citations) and Biomedical Engineering (105 citations). Digby Wrede has collaborated with scholars based in Australia and United States. Frequent co-authors include Aidyn Mouradov, Ana F. Miranda, Trevor W. Stevenson, Mohamed Taha, Andrew S. Ball, Krishna K. Kadali, Nazim Muradov, Amit C. Gujar, Paul D. Morrison and Stephen Gray. Their work appears in journals such as Biotechnology for Biofuels, Water Science & Technology and PLoS ONE.
